Yoshio Arai is a scholar working on Materials Chemistry, Mechanical Engineering and Mechanics of Materials. According to data from OpenAlex, Yoshio Arai has authored 150 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 59 papers in Materials Chemistry, 54 papers in Mechanical Engineering and 40 papers in Mechanics of Materials. Recurrent topics in Yoshio Arai's work include Aluminum Alloys Composites Properties (23 papers), Advanced ceramic materials synthesis (22 papers) and Advancements in Solid Oxide Fuel Cells (19 papers). Yoshio Arai is often cited by papers focused on Aluminum Alloys Composites Properties (23 papers), Advanced ceramic materials synthesis (22 papers) and Advancements in Solid Oxide Fuel Cells (19 papers). Yoshio Arai collaborates with scholars based in Japan, Bangladesh and United States.
